Title: Lead Sales Analytics & Reporting Analyst
Location: This position is based in our Campbell, California offices. This position is on-site, full-time

What You'll Do
The Lead Sales Analytics & Reporting Analyst is responsible for commercial analytics, reporting, and decision support for the Commercial organization. This role partners closely with Commercial Leadership, IT and Finance to transform commercial data into actionable insights that improve sales performance, forecasting, territory effectiveness, and operational decision-making.
As a trusted analytical advisor to Commercial Leadership, this individual develops scalable reporting, advanced analytics, and business intelligence solutions utilizing modern analytics platforms and AI-enabled technologies. The Lead Analyst delivers timely insights, identifies trends, and provides analytical recommendations that enable informed business decisions across the commercial organization.
As the senior individual contributor for Commercial Analytics & Reporting within Sales Operations, this role owns commercial analytics, reporting, forecast modeling, statistical analysis, territory inputs, pipeline analytics, and business intelligence reporting while operating within enterprise data governance standards.

About Imperative Care

Imperative Care is a medical device company that develops and commercializes devices for the treatment of ischemic stroke. The company was founded in 2016 by Fred Khosravi and Vikram Janardhan. Imperative Care's flagship product is the Zoom Aspiration System, which is used to remove blood clots from the brain during a stroke. The company's mission is to improve patient outcomes and reduce the burden of stroke on healthcare systems. Imperative Care has raised over $85 million in funding from investors such as Ascension Ventures, Bain Capital Life Sciences, and Rock Springs Capital.
